within the Employment Legal Team, your role is to assist clients with Early Conciliation and Tribunal matters by assuming conduct, from advising on merits of a case, drafting responses to exchanging witness statements as well as completing telephone preliminary hearings. Responsibilities To include but not limited to: Reviewing Tribunal and Early Conciliation matters including complex open track matters Drafting of responses, witness statements and relevant applications Dealing with all aspects of document disclosure and creation of bundles Liaising with Tribunals, Claimants’ representatives and clients Discussing merits of a case and achieving commercially favourable settlements Working alongside and supporting corporate clients as a dedicated Litigation Executive Conducting preliminary hearings by telephone Personal attributes / skills Law degree (or GDL) plus good experience and/or a professional qualification (LPC / BPTC). A real commitment to helping our clients through a difficult time. A positive approach to a busy workload and teamwork. A genuine passion for employment law and attention to detail.
